The `os` module does not exist here; use `posix` instead. 3. The singular `=` sign is used for both assignment AND comparison (a nightmare, I know.) 4. Some things may be unstable, it is not fully tested. I'll have to read through the whole codebase later. - +5. If you cannot import modules from the standard library, try setting the PYTHONPATH environment variable to the location of the `lib` directory. For example, to use a standard library from ~/py091/lib, run the command like this: `PYTHONPATH=~/py091/lib /path/to/python **args` > Original README is at README.original |
